(AGIO) reported a first-quarter 2026 net loss per share of -$1.69, beating the consensus estimate of -$1.8367 by approximately 7.99%. The company did not disclose revenue for the quarter. The stock declined 2.26% in the session following the announcement, reflecting investor caution despite the narrower-than-expected loss.

During the first quarter of 2026, Agios management highlighted progress in its lead therapeutic programs, particularly in pyruvate kinase (PK) deficiency and other rare genetic diseases. The company reported that it continues to invest in research and development while streamlining operating expenses, contributing to the favorable EPS variance versus analyst expectations. Operating expenses were carefully managed, with general and administrative costs declining modestly from prior periods. The net loss of -$1.69 per share reflects these cost-control efforts, even as revenue remained absent—the company has yet to generate product sales from its pipeline candidates. Agios also noted ongoing enrollment in pivotal clinical trials, with no major safety signals reported. The narrower loss suggests the company is achieving better operational efficiency while advancing its late-stage programs. Looking ahead, Agios management reiterated its strategic focus on bringing its PK deficiency therapy to market, with a potential regulatory filing planned for late 2026 or early 2027. The company expects to provide topline data from key trials in the coming quarters. Guidance for full-year 2026 operating expenses was not formally updated, but the firm anticipates R&D spending to remain elevated as it scales manufacturing and prepares for commercialization. Risk factors include the uncertainty of clinical trial outcomes, potential delays in regulatory review, and the need for additional financing to support pre-launch activities. The company may also explore partnership opportunities for non-core programs to preserve cash. Overall, the near-term outlook remains cautious, with Agios focused on executing its clinical milestones and managing its burn rate. Market reaction to the Q1 2026 report was muted, with AGIO shares declining 2.26% on the day. Analysts noted that while the EPS beat was positive, the lack of revenue visibility and ongoing cash burn continue to weigh on sentiment. Some analysts viewed the narrower loss as a sign of improved financial discipline, but many remain on the sidelines pending definitive clinical data. Key events to watch include the release of pivotal trial results for mitapivat in PK deficiency and any updates on the company’s regulatory pathway. Investor attention will also focus on cash runway updates and potential partnering discussions. The stock may remain volatile until a clearer revenue catalyst emerges.
